mac上传文件到linux
时间: 2023-03-19 13:26:20 浏览: 85
要将文件从Mac上传到Linux,可以使用以下步骤:
1. 在Mac上打开终端,使用scp命令将文件上传到Linux服务器。例如,如果要将文件file.txt上传到Linux服务器的/home/user目录中,可以使用以下命令:
scp file.txt user@linux-server:/home/user
其中,user是Linux服务器的用户名,linux-server是Linux服务器的IP地址或主机名。
2. 输入Linux服务器的密码,然后等待文件上传完成。
3. 可以使用ssh命令登录到Linux服务器,然后检查文件是否已成功上传到目标目录中。
注意:在上传文件之前,确保Mac和Linux服务器之间已建立可靠的网络连接,并且您具有足够的权限将文件上传到目标目录中。
相关问题
怎么把文件传到虚拟机linux
如果您的虚拟机Linux和宿主机Windows/Mac OS在同一台电脑上,您可以使用共享文件夹将文件从宿主机传输到虚拟机Linux。
首先,在虚拟机软件的设置中启用共享文件夹功能,并将要共享的文件夹设置为宿主机中的一个文件夹。
接下来,在虚拟机Linux中打开终端,输入以下命令:
sudo mkdir /mnt/share (创建文件夹)
sudo mount -t vboxsf share /mnt/share (挂载共享文件夹)
这样,宿主机中的共享文件夹就会被挂载到虚拟机Linux的/mnt/share目录下。
然后,您就可以在虚拟机Linux中使用cp命令将文件复制到共享文件夹中,从而实现文件传输。
如果您的虚拟机Linux和宿主机不在同一台电脑上,您可以使用FTP或SCP协议进行文件传输。具体操作步骤可参考网上的教程。
Macbook如何上传文件压缩包到Linux云服务器并正常解压打开
您可以使用scp命令将文件传输到Linux云服务器。以下是具体步骤:
1. 在Macbook端打开终端,进入到存放文件压缩包的目录下。
2. 使用scp命令将文件传输到Linux云服务器。命令格式如下:
```
scp [压缩包路径] [用户名]@[服务器IP]:[目标路径]
```
其中,[压缩包路径]为文件压缩包在Macbook端的路径,[用户名]@[服务器IP]为Linux云服务器的登录账号和IP地址,[目标路径]为文件要上传到Linux云服务器的目标路径。
例如,如果要将文件压缩包上传到Linux云服务器的/home/user目录下,命令如下:
```
scp /Users/username/Documents/file.zip user@server_ip:/home/user/
```
3. 在Linux云服务器上解压文件。使用unzip命令对压缩包进行解压,命令格式如下:
```
unzip [压缩包名称]
```
例如,如果压缩包名称为file.zip,命令如下:
```
unzip file.zip
```
4. 查看解压后的文件是否正确。使用ls命令查看解压后的文件列表,命令如下:
```
ls
```
如果文件列表中包含了您需要的文件,则说明解压成功。
注意事项:
1. 确保Macbook和Linux云服务器之间可以互相访问。
2. 确保Linux云服务器上已经安装了unzip工具。
3. 确保上传的压缩包没有损坏。